Learn how to reuse, recycle, restyle, restore, and revamp your old furnishings to create a stylish and unique home, without spending a fortune! Whether you are on a tight budget, or simply want to give your existing home a new look, Thrifty Chic provides a treasure trove of ideas at your fingertips.

Divided into 7 chapters, Thrifty Chic will take you through everything you need to know to jazz-up your home. Starting with "Elements of Design", you will learn how to utilise fabric, paint, windows, frames, lighting, and more to make the most of your environment.

Then, room by room, each chapter will show you how best to pull together mismatched items into cohesive schemes, how to upcycle furniture, and how to introduce some clever ideas for storage. You will learn how to create certain styles in your home, from French-inspired antique chic to the cosmopolitan eclectic and the steel-finished urban cutting-edge.

You will even gain insider tips on what to look for at antique markets and in thrift stores, and how to care for and restore your bargain purchases.

Packed full of irresistible designs, and with a final chapter detailing how to do the projects yourself, there will be no stopping you from creating your perfect habitat.

About the Author

Liz Bauwens is a freelance stylist who has worked for House and Garden, Good Housekeeping, Country Homes and Interiors and Habitat. Liz has also opened her own store, Otto Trading, which is filled with a unique mix of new and vintage homeware, glassware and furniture, as well as cards and one-off gifts. Alexandra Campbell is an author whose work has appeared in many newspapers and magazines, including The Times Magazine, The Financial Times 'How To Spend It' magazine and The Daily Telegraph. She is also the author of nine novels and now blogs at themiddlesizedgarden.co.uk, an award-winning gardening blog. Together they are the authors of Flea Market Chic, Country in the City, and Upcycled Chic and Modern Hacks, all available from CICO Books. Liz Bauwens lives in west London and Alexandra Campbell lives in Kent.
